Start With Regulation and Ownership

The first checkpoint is the operator’s legal identity. A trustworthy casino should clearly state the company name, registered address, licensing authority, and applicable terms. This information is usually available in the footer or on a dedicated legal page. If ownership details are vague, incomplete, or difficult to verify, caution is justified.

Licensing does not guarantee a perfect experience, but it establishes a framework for player protection. Regulators commonly require controls covering age verification, anti-money-laundering procedures, complaint handling, and the security of customer funds. Check whether the licence number is genuine and whether it corresponds to the website you intend to use.

  • Confirm the licence and operating company.
  • Read the casino’s terms before making a deposit.
  • Check how disputes and complaints are handled.
  • Look for clear responsible gambling information.

Compare Games, Software, and Fairness

A large game count is not automatically a sign of quality. What matters is the variety, reputation, and transparency of the software providers behind the titles. Established studios generally publish information about random number generation, return-to-player percentages, and game rules.

Slots should display their volatility and RTP where practical, while table games need accessible rules and payout information. Live casino products should identify the studio, table limits, and applicable betting procedures. Independent testing organisations may audit random number generators, adding another useful layer of confidence.

Read Bonuses Beyond the Headline

Promotional offers can be useful, but the headline value is only one part of the calculation. A welcome bonus may include wagering requirements, maximum bet restrictions, qualifying games, payment limitations, expiry dates, and maximum conversion rules. These conditions can significantly affect the real value of the promotion.

Compare the cash balance and bonus balance separately. Some casinos restrict withdrawals until wagering is complete, while others provide lower-playthrough offers or occasional bonuses with no wagering requirement. Never allow a promotion to dictate spending beyond your planned entertainment budget.

Evaluate Deposits, Withdrawals, and Support

Payment quality often separates a dependable casino from a frustrating one. The cashier should explain minimum and maximum limits, processing times, fees, verification requirements, and supported currencies before you commit funds. It is sensible to test a small withdrawal rather than depositing a large amount immediately.

Identity checks are normal, especially before withdrawals. However, the documentation requested should be proportionate and processed through secure channels. Customer support should be reachable through at least one practical method, such as live chat, email, or telephone. Test support with a specific question and judge the accuracy, speed, and tone of the response.

Use Responsible Gambling Controls

Responsible gambling is not an optional extra; it is part of a sound casino experience. Look for deposit limits, loss limits, session reminders, cooling-off periods, and self-exclusion tools. These features are most effective when activated before play becomes difficult to control.

Set a fixed entertainment budget and treat losses as the cost of the activity, never as an amount that must be recovered. Avoid playing with borrowed money, chasing losses, or increasing stakes after an emotional event. If gambling begins to affect finances, sleep, work, or relationships, stop and contact an appropriate support service in your country.
